The Value of a Brand

Ken ZangaraHaving been a Dodge dealer for 22 years I realize the value of a brand.  During that 22 years the value of my dealership varied a great deal depending on how Dodge was doing.  The fluctuation was huge and ranged from zero to several million dollars.  Some brands remain strong all the time but most will suffer through fluctuation like the Dodge brand.  Ford and GM brands have greatly fluctuated.  Even Toyota has not been immune due to recent quality problems.  Almost all dealers understand that the value can vary depending on how that brand is doing at the time.

Why Do I need a Branded Used Car?

Not so smart dealers just don’t get it!  They ask the question, “Why do I need a branded used car?”  There are many reasons why the AutoStar brand is so valuable.  With the EverStar Lifetime Engine Guarantee and Lifetime Safety Features, the perceived value of a vehicle with that protection is $1500-2500 higher than a vehicle without that protection.  To upgrade the EverStar program to a more comprehensive extended service contract is easy.  Many of our dealers are enjoying 70% or more extended service contract penetration.  The most important reason to sell the AutoStar nationally branded used car is that customers must come back to the selling dealer every three months or 3000 miles, whichever comes first, for all scheduled maintenance to maintain eligibility for the EverStar Guarantees.  This equates to huge service absorption in AutoStar dealerships.
